MICROPOROUS HYDROPHILIC MEMBRANE |
摘要 |
<p>A hydrophilic microporous membrane comprising a thermoplastic resin, having been subjected to hydrophilizing treatment and having a maximum pore size of 10 to 100 nm, wherein when 3 wt% bovine immunoglobulin having a monomer ratio of 80 wt% or more is filtered at a constant pressure of 0.3 MPa, an average permeation rate (liter/m<2>/h) for 5 minutes from the start of filtration (briefly referred to as globulin permeation rate A) satisfies the following formula (1) and an average permeation rate (liter/m<2>/h) for 5 minutes from the time point of 55 minutes after the start of filtration (briefly referred to as globulin permeation rate B) satisfies the following formula (2): <DF NUM="(1)">Globulin permeation rate A > 0.0015 x maximum pore size (nm)<2.75> </DF> <DF NUM="(2).">Globulin permeation rate B/globulin permeation rate A > 0.2 </DF></p> |
